exhibition insurance coverage, also known as event insurance, is a type of policy designed to protect exhibitors from potential risks associated with participating in an exhibition. This type of insurance can provide coverage for various scenarios, including property damage, theft, liability claims, and even cancellation or postponement of the event due to unforeseen circumstances.

One of the primary reasons why exhibition insurance coverage is essential is to protect exhibitors from financial loss in case of any unfortunate events. For example, if your exhibit booth gets damaged during transportation or set up, exhibition insurance can help cover the cost of repairs or replacements. Similarly, if any of your products or artwork gets stolen during the event, the insurance policy can compensate you for the loss.

Liability coverage is another important aspect of exhibition insurance. In case someone gets injured at your exhibit booth or if your products cause harm to a visitor, you could be held liable for their medical expenses or damages. Exhibition insurance can help cover these costs, ensuring that you are not left with a hefty bill.

Moreover, exhibition insurance can also provide coverage in case the event gets canceled or postponed due to reasons beyond your control, such as a natural disaster, pandemic, or unforeseen circumstances. This can help protect your financial investment in the event, including booth rental fees, travel expenses, and other costs associated with participating.

When shopping for exhibition insurance coverage, there are a few key factors to consider. Firstly, you should assess the level of coverage you need based on the type of event you are participating in and the value of the items you will be showcasing. Make sure to read the policy document carefully to understand what is covered and any exclusions that may apply.

It is also important to consider the reputation and financial stability of the insurance provider. Look for an insurer with experience in providing exhibition insurance coverage and a track record of reliable customer service. You may also want to compare quotes from different insurers to find the best coverage at a competitive price.

Before purchasing exhibition insurance, it is advisable to consult with an experienced insurance broker or agent who can guide you through the process and help you determine the right level of coverage for your needs. They can also assist you in understanding the terms and conditions of the policy and make sure that you are adequately protected.
